电路常用常用的定理/定律/计算方法

1、欧姆定理

在恒定温度下,导体中的电流I与导体两端的电压U成正比,与导体的电阻R成反比。U=IR

2、基尔霍夫定律

2.1基尔霍夫电流定律(KCL)

在电路中任何一个节点上,任意时刻,流入节点的电流之和等于流出节点的电流之和。

I入1+I入2+…=I出1+I出2+…

2.2基尔霍夫电压定律(KVL)

在一个闭合回路中,沿着该路径的各个电子器件上的电压之和等于电源电压之和。

U1+U2+U3+…=U(电源)

3、戴维南定理

任何一个线性有源二端网络可以用一个等效的戴维南电压源 Vth 和一个串联等效电阻 Rth 替代。这个等效电压源和电阻能够在外部观察点上产生与原始电路完全相同的电压和电流响应。

戴维南等效电压:Vth是从开路位置观察到的两个开路端口之间的电压。(求开路电压)

戴维南等效电阻:Rth是在电路中所有独立电源被短路时,从观察端口看到的等效电阻。

在解决电路的某一支路中的电流和电压问题时,比使用传统的支路电流法或节点电压法更为简便,仅适用于线性电路

4、诺顿定理

诺顿定理是指一个线性时不变的含源二端网络可以用一个电流源代替,该电流源的电流等于网络端口的短路电流,而其内阻等于网络内全部独立源置零时的输入电阻

二端网络的等效的电压源与电阻串联也可以等效成电流源与电阻并联(条件:Is=Us/Rs,电流源的方向等于电压源的-端指向+端)(对外等效

5、电源等效

电流源与电压源串联等效于电流源,电流源与电压源并联等效于电压源。不影响外部电路。对外等效

6、叠加定理

在一个线性电路中,任何一支路的电流或电压可以视为各个独立电源单独作用时,在该支路产生的电流或电压的代数和。仅适用于线性电路。

1. 电源单独作用:对于电路中的每一个独立电源(包括电压源和电流源),假设其他电源不存在。对于电压源,将其余的电压源短路(但保留其内阻);对于电流源,将其余的电流源开路(同样保留其内阻)。(但电路的其他部分(包括线性元件和受控源)保持不变)

2. 计算分量:在每一个假设条件下,计算目标支路的电流或电压。这将得到每个电源单独作用时的电流或电压分量。

3. 结果叠加:将所有单独电源作用下的电流或电压分量按照它们的符号进行代数相加,得到最终的电流或电压值。

7. 支路电流法

以支路电流为未知量的电路分析方法,适用于支路数较少的复杂电路。

1)找出节点数,根据KCL列出(支路数-节点数+1)个的节点列方程

2)找出支路数,根据KVL列出(支路数-节点数+1)个回路方程列方程

联立1)和2)方程代入数值,解方程。

8. 节点电位法

节点电压法以基尔霍夫电流定律(KCL)为基础,利用电路中选定的参考节点,来表达其他各节点的电压。节点数较多的复杂电路优先选择节点电压法。

1. 选择参考节点:在电路中选择一个节点作为参考节点(或称为地),其余节点相对于这个参考节点的电压即为节点电压。

2. 标识节点电压:对除参考节点外的每个节点,假设一个节点电压,这个电压是相对于参考节点的电压。

3. 应用基尔霍夫电流定律(KCL):在每个非参考节点应用KCL,即对于任一节点,流入节点的电流之和等于流出节点的电流之和。用节点电压表示这些电流。 (利用U/R来表示流过电阻的电流)

(电路中有含电压源与电阻串联的支路,将他们等效成电流源与电阻并联解决)

(两节点之间只含理想电压源的设流过的电流为I(有方向),把I写入方程组,并补充一条关于两节点的电压方程(Unx+Us=Uny)来解方程组)

(支路中有电流源串联电阻,用电流源代替(忽略电阻),支路中有电压源并联电阻,用电压源代替(忽略电阻))

4. 建立方程组:将步骤3中得到的KCL方程组合起来,形成一个方程组。

5. 求解方程组:解这个方程组以得到各个节点的电压。

6. 计算支路电流:一旦得到了节点电压,就可以根据欧姆定律计算出各支路的电流。

9. 网孔电流法

通过假设在电路的各个网孔(即电路中的独立回路)中流动的电流来计算电路中的电压和电流。这种方法基于基尔霍夫电压定律(KVL),特别适用于支路较多而网孔较少的电路。

1. 确定网孔:识别电路中的所有网孔。网孔是指电路中没有其他支路内部的简单回路。

2. 假设网孔电流:为每个网孔假设一个网孔电流,这个电流被假想为在网孔中流动。通常情况下,所有网孔电流的假设方向都是一致的(例如,全部假设为顺时针方向)。

3. 应用基尔霍夫电压定律(KVL):对每个网孔应用KVL。即对于每个网孔,沿网孔路径的所有电压升之和等于所有电压降之和。

4. 建立方程组:将步骤3中得到的KVL方程组合起来,形成一个线性方程组。这些方程将网孔电流与电路中的电压源和电阻联系起来。

5. 求解方程组:解这个线性方程组以得到各个网孔的电流。

6. 计算支路电流:一旦得到了网孔电流,就可以根据它们的值和方向计算出电路中各个支路的实际电流。
 

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.rhkb.cn/news/30555.html

如若内容造成侵权/违法违规/事实不符,请联系长河编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

unity 让两个物体相遇时候刚体互不影响

解决方案是设定好层级不同,在PlayerSetting中找到物理,有一个图层碰撞矩阵 取消对应 勾选即可 如图

编译Telegram Desktop

目录 一、前言 二、环境准备 2.1 2.2 2.3 2.4 2.5 2.6 2.7 2.8 三、编译 四、总结和学习 一、前言 Telegram 是一款全球广泛使用的即时通讯软件,以其强大的隐私保护、跨平台同步和丰富的功能而闻名。它支持一对一聊天、群组(最多20万成员&am…

(十七) Nginx解析:架构设计、负载均衡实战与常见面试问题

什么是Nginx? Nginx 是一款高性能的 HTTP 服务器和反向代理服务器,同时支持 IMAP/POP3/SMTP 协议。其设计以高并发、低资源消耗为核心优势,广泛应用于负载均衡、静态资源服务和反向代理等场景。 一、Nginx 的核心优势 高并发处理能力采用异步非阻塞的…

PCIE接口

PCIE接口 PIC接口介绍PIC总线结构PCI总线特点PCI总线的主要性能PIC的历程 PCIE接口介绍PCIe接口总线位宽PCIE速率GT/s和Gbps区别PCIE带宽计算 PCIE架构PCIe体系结构端到端的差分数据传递PCIe总线的层次结构事务层数据链路层物理层PCIe层级结构及功能框图 PCIe链路初始化PCIe链路…

边缘计算盒子:解决交通拥堵的智能方案

在当今的智能交通系统中,边缘计算盒子(Edge Computing Box)正逐渐成为不可或缺的核心组件。这种设备通过将计算能力下沉到网络边缘,极大地提升了数据处理的速度和效率,特别适用于实时性要求极高的交通监控场景。本文将…

INFINI Labs 产品更新 | Easysearch 增加异步搜索等新特性

INFINI Labs 产品更新发布!此次更新,Easysearch 增加了新的功能和数据类型,包括 wildcard 数据类型、Point in time 搜索 API、异步搜索 API、数值和日期字段的 doc-values 搜索支持,Console 新增了日志查询功能。 INFINI Easyse…

Kotlin从入门到精通:开启高效编程之旅

目录 一、为什么选择 Kotlin 二、Kotlin 基础语法入门​ 2.1 Hello, Kotlin​ 2.2 变量与数据类型​ 2.2.1 可变与不可变变量​ 2.2.2 基本数据类型​ 2.2.3 数组​ 三、Kotlin 流程控制与函数​ 3.1 流程控制语句​ 3.1.1 if 表达式​ 3.1.2 when 表达式​ 3.2 函…

大模型量化技术实践指南:GPTQ、AWQ、BitsandBytes 和 Unsloth

在大模型(LLM)的时代,我们需要了解量化技术,以便在本地电脑上运行这些模型,因为它们的规模非常庞大。然而,实现量化的方法有很多,这让像我这样的初学者很容易感到困惑。本文介绍了我们必须掌握的…

C51 Proteus仿真实验16:4X4矩阵键盘控制条形LED显示

说明 按下的按键值越大点亮的LED越多 Proteus仿真 注意: K1、K5、K9、K13左边引脚连接的是P1.0 K2、K6、K10、K14左边引脚连接的是P1.1 K3、K7、K11、K15左边引脚连接的是P1.2 K4、K8、K12、K16左边引脚连接的是P1.3 K1、K2、K3、K4右边引脚连接的是P1.4 K5、K6、…

Hive的架构

1. 概念 Hive 是建立在 Hadoop 上的数据仓库工具,旨在简化大规模数据集的查询与管理。它通过类 SQL 语言(HiveQL)将结构化数据映射为 Hadoop 的 MapReduce,适合离线批处理,尤其适用于数据仓库场景。 2. 数据模型 表&a…

P8686 [蓝桥杯 2019 省 A] 修改数组--并查集

P8686 [蓝桥杯 2019 省 A] 修改数组--并查集 题目 解析代码 题目 解析 首先先让所有的f(i)i,即每个人最开始的祖先都是自己,然后就每一次都让轮到那个数的父亲1,第二次出现的时候就直接用父亲替换掉 并查集适用场景 …

GitHub上传项目

总结(有基础的话直接执行这几步,就不需要再往下看了): git init 修改git的config文件:添加:[user]:name你的github用户名 email你注册github的用户名 git branch -m master main git remote add origin 你的URL gi…

关于Windows输入法切换的一些总结

语言和键盘的关系(第一层是语言 语言下一层是键盘) 如下图:语言就是 中文 英文 阿拉伯文之类的 键盘就是 语言中文下的:XX输入法 语言的切换 和 键盘(输入法)的切换 (用windos空格 可以切换…

C# Unity 唐老狮 No.7 模拟面试题

本文章不作任何商业用途 仅作学习与交流 安利唐老狮与其他老师合作的网站,内有大量免费资源和优质付费资源,我入门就是看唐老师的课程 打好坚实的基础非常非常重要: 全部 - 游习堂 - 唐老狮创立的游戏开发在线学习平台 - Powered By EduSoho 如果你发现了文章内特殊的字体格式,…

搜广推校招面经三十九

小红书﹣图搜 一、两个整数的汉明距离 两个整数之间的汉明距离是指这两个数字对应二进制位相同位置不同的个数。换句话说,它就是将一个整数变成另一个整数所需要改变的二进制位的数量。例如,如果两个整数在它们的二进制表示中有三个位置上的…

conda list <package> 指令输出的build和channel含义

Build:表示当前安装包的 构建版本,即该包的编译、构建、发布的具体版本。通常包含一些额外的标识,帮助你区分同一包的不同版本。 Channel: 表示该包的 来源渠道,即该包是从哪个 Anaconda 仓库(频道&#…

Windows下配置Flutter移动开发环境以及AndroidStudio安装和模拟机配置

截止 2025/3/9 ,版本更新到了 3.29.1 ,但是为了防止出现一些奇怪的bug,我安装的还是老一点的,3.19,其他版本的安装同理。AndroidStudio用的是 2024/3/1 版本。 — 1 环境变量(Windows) PUB_H…

Linux系统编程--线程同步

目录 一、前言 二、线程饥饿 三、线程同步 四、条件变量 1、cond 2、条件变量的使用 五、条件变量与互斥锁 一、前言 上篇文章我们讲解了线程互斥的概念,为了防止多个线程同时访问一份临界资源而出问题,我们引入了线程互斥,线程互斥其实…

学习小程序开发--Day1

项目学习开篇 项目架构 项目进程 创建uni-app项目 通过HBuilderX创建 小结 page.json 和 tabBar 目录文件 pages.json的配置

在word下写公式

需求 word的可视化编辑公式是好的,但是很丑(见下图) 我希望公式是这样的(见下图) 解决方案 1.先转换为“线性”(即Latex格式) 2.得到下面这个玩意,把\mathrm去掉(功能是…